import javafx.application.Application;
import javafx.scene.Group;
import javafx.scene.Scene;
import javafx.scene.canvas.Canvas;
import javafx.scene.canvas.GraphicsContext;
import javafx.stage.Stage;
import javafx.scene.paint.Color;

public class Othello extends Application {
    private final int scale = 40;
    private final int space = 3;

    public void start(Stage stage) {
        stage.setTitle("IZ");

        final Canvas canvas = new Canvas(scale * 8 + 1, scale * 8 + 1);
        GraphicsContext gc = canvas.getGraphicsContext2D();

        int[][] state = {{0,1,2,0,1,2,0,1}, {2,0,1,2,0,1,2,0}, {1,2,0,1,2,0,1,2},
                {0,1,2,0,1,2,0,1}, {2,0,1,2,0,1,2,0}, {1,2,0,1,2,0,1,2},
                {0,1,2,0,1,2,0,1}, {2,0,1,2,0,1,2,0}};
        int i,j;

        for (i = 0; i < 8; i++) {
            for (j = 0; j < 8; j++) {
                gc.setFill(Color.GREEN);
                gc.fillRect(i * scale, j * scale, scale, scale);
                gc.setStroke(Color.BLACK);
                gc.strokeRect(i * scale, j * scale, scale, scale);
                if (state[i][j] == 1) {
                    gc.setFill(Color.WHITE);
                    gc.fillOval(i * scale + space, j * scale + space, scale - space * 2, scale - space * 2);
                } else if (state[i][j] == 2) {
                    gc.setFill(Color.BLACK);
                    gc.fillOval(i * scale + space, j * scale + space, scale - space * 2, scale - space * 2);
                }
            }
        }

        Group root = new Group();
        root.getChildren().addAll(canvas);
        Scene scene = new Scene(root);
        stage.setScene(scene);
        stage.show();
    }

    public static void main(String... args) {
        launch(args);
    }
}
